Inadequate Air flow



You need to examine if your cooling and heating system has ample air movement to make certain optimal efficiency.

Insufficient air flow can bring about a range of issues, such as minimized cooling or home heating capacity, ineffective procedure, and raised power consumption.

One method to check for air flow problems is by inspecting the air filters. Dirty or clogged up filters can limit air flow, so make sure to clean or replace them regularly.



Furthermore, examine the vents and signs up to ensure they aren't blocked by furniture or other things.

An additional typical reason for inadequate airflow is a malfunctioning blower electric motor. If you observe weak air flow or unusual sounds originating from the motor, it may require to be repaired or replaced.

Thermostat Issues



If your HVAC system is experiencing thermostat issues, it's important to resolve them promptly to make certain proper temperature control and power efficiency. Here are some common thermostat problems and how to prevent them:

- Inaccurate temperature level readings:
- Calibrate your thermostat routinely to guarantee accurate temperature level readings.
- Maintain the thermostat away from warmth sources or drafts that can affect its accuracy.

- Thermostat not reacting:
- Examine if the thermostat is appropriately linked to the a/c system.
- Change the batteries if the thermostat is battery-operated.

By addressing these thermostat problems, you can guarantee that your HVAC system preserves the preferred temperature level and operates effectively.

Refrigerant Leaks



One common cooling and heating issue that you might come across is refrigerant leakages, which can significantly influence the efficiency and efficiency of your system. When refrigerant leaks occur, it not only influences the cooling capacity of your a/c unit but additionally brings about greater energy intake and increased energy costs.

Here are a couple of reasons that refrigerant leaks occur:

- Rust: With time, the cooling agent lines can create rust, which can trigger tiny openings or fractures in the pipelines, bring about leaks.

- Poor installation: If the HVAC system wasn't installed properly, it can result in loose fittings or connections, allowing refrigerant to escape.

- Deterioration: Continual use and aging of the system can cause wear and tear on the parts, consisting of the cooling agent lines, enhancing the possibility of leakages.

Normal upkeep and inspections can aid find and take care of refrigerant leakages promptly, making certain optimal efficiency and performance of your a/c system.

Ignition or Pilot Troubles



When you experience ignition or pilot problems, it's important to address them quickly to guarantee appropriate functioning of your HVAC system.

Ignition or pilot troubles can take place when the ignition system falls short to spark the gas or when the pilot burner goes out. These problems can result in an absence of warm or warm water in your home.

To avoid ignition or pilot issues, it's essential to frequently inspect and cleanse the ignition system and pilot light. In addition, make certain to check if the gas supply is turned on and if there are any obstructions in the gas line.
